Abstract

The present invention relates to a kind of elastic concrete, including binder materials, slag, land plaster, blast-furnace cinder, natural emulsion, Portland clinker, slag, montmorillonite and rubble, its feed components by weight, 18 25 parts of 60 80 parts of the binder materials, 10 13 parts of slag, 14 18 parts of land plaster, 7 10 parts of blast-furnace cinder, 6 10 parts of natural emulsion, 8 15 parts of Portland clinker, 9 11 parts of slag, 0 28 parts of montmorillonite 2 and rubble.The present invention can prevent concrete cracking, improve concrete flexural strength and toughness, the fracture width of limitation, the cracking of resistance concrete surface and antiknock fire resistance property, can be widely applied to the concrete structure in the fields such as building, water conservancy, municipal traffic, ocean military project.

Description

A kind of elastic concrete
Technical field
The invention belongs to building field, is related to a kind of elastic concrete.
Background technology
With the rise of real estate industry in recent years, civilian or commercial house is more and more in each city, but room The focus that room quality is also paid attention to as people simultaneously, such as house leak, house are gone mouldy problems, even if some house tops Waterproof layer processing was done in portion, side wall, but still can be made moist and be gone mouldy because of weather or other factors.
The content of the invention
The technical problem to be solved in the present invention is:Overcome the technical problem that house sidings moisture-sensitive is gone mouldy in the prior art, A kind of waterproof, anti-mildew, light elastic concrete are provided.
The technical solution adopted for the present invention to solve the technical problems is:A kind of elastic concrete, including gelling material are provided Material, slag, land plaster, blast-furnace cinder, natural emulsion, Portland clinker, slag, montmorillonite and rubble, its raw material each group Point by weight, described binder materials 60-80 parts, slag 10-13 parts, land plaster 14-18 parts, blast-furnace cinder 7-10 parts, natural Latex 6-10 parts, Portland clinker 8-15 parts, slag 9-11 parts, montmorillonite 2 0-28 parts and rubble 18-25 parts.
Preferably, described elastic concrete, it is characterized in that:Its feed components by weight, 80 parts of binder materials, 13 parts of slag, 18 parts of land plaster, 10 parts of blast-furnace cinder, 10 parts of natural emulsion, 15 parts of Portland clinker, 11 parts of slag, illiteracy Take off 25 parts of 28 parts of stone and rubble.
Preferably, described elastic concrete, it is characterized in that having following steps:
(1) good various raw materials are configured by weight ratio;
(2) the various raw materials configured are added in stirred reactor one by one, stirred under conditions of rotating speed is 60rpm 2h, you can be made.
The present invention can prevent concrete cracking, improve concrete flexural strength and toughness, the fracture width of limitation, resistance Concrete surface is cracked and antiknock fire resistance property, can be widely applied to the fields such as building, water conservancy, municipal traffic, ocean military project Concrete structure.
